On 3/3/20 7:17 PM, Stephen Rothwell wrote: > Hi all, > > After merging the block tree, today's linux-next build (powerpc > ppc64_defconfig) produced this warning: > > fs/io_uring.c: In function 'io_close': > fs/io_uring.c:3415:3: warning: ignoring return value of 'refcount_inc_not_zero', declared with attribute warn_unused_result [-Wunused-result] > 3415 | refcount_inc_not_zero(&req->refs); > | 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 > > Introduced by commit > > 62e0c6b73a2c ("io_uring: make submission ref putting consistent")
That should just be a refcount_inc() and also looks like it should happen before the async queue. I'll fix it up.
